Charlotte
Advances to National Championship Final for Third
Consecutive Year
Eagles Defeat
Pittsburgh 2-1 Tonight to Cap Off
6-1 Aggregate
Series Win
(Charlotte, NC) - The Charlotte Eagles have advanced to the
USL-2 National Championship Final for the third consecutive
year and have earned the right to defend their 2005
Championship Title. Charlotte defeated the Pittsburgh
Riverhounds tonight 2-1 and won the series with a 6-1
aggregate goal advantage. Charlotte will face the
winner of the Richmond / Cincinnati series on August 26th.
David Flavius got the first goal of tongiht's
match in the 14th minute giving Pittsburgh the 1-0 lead. Jason Kutney set
up the goal working down the right side and serving the ball into the middle for
Flavius. Flavius volleyed it in from eight yards out with a one-timer.
The Charlotte Eagles answered in the 42nd minute
with a goal by Joseph Kabwe. Kabwe collected the ball in the midfield and
pushed it through some congestion before touching it to Jacob Coggins.
Coggins put a pass right back to Kabwe on the run, breaking through the defense.
Kabwe touched the ball right and then beat McNellis to the right side of the net
to tie up the match 1-1. The first half ended even at one goal a piece.
Andriy Budnyy scored the game winning goal for
Charlotte in the 76th minute of play. Dustin Swinehart served the ball
from midfield, connecting with the run of Budnyy with a breakaway. Budnyy
placed the shot in the lower right corner to beat McNellis. The match
finished with a 2-1 win for Charlotte. Dan Benton had 5 saves for
Charlotte including a great diving save in the 58th minute to prevent Pittsburgh
from taking back the lead. Terry McNellis had three saves for Pittsburgh
including a diving save in the 71st minute to rob Jacob Coggins of a goal.
|
Eagles head coach
Mark Steffens commented on the Eagles strategy
tonight: "Our plan for tonight was to
possess the ball in the attacking half to
prevent Pittsburgh from getting many
opportunities. We didn't do a great job of
that in the first half but we really cleaned it
up a bit in the second." |
With tonight's 2-1 victory the Eagles extended
their series aggregate goal lead to 6-1 and have advanced to the USL-2 National
Championship match. The National final will be played on August 26th and
broadcast live on Fox Soccer Channel at 8:00 pm eastern time. Charlotte
will face the winner of the Richmond / Cincinnati series which will wrap up
tomorrow night. If Richmond wins the series then the final will be in
Richmond. If Cincinnati wins then Charlotte will
host the National final, details will be posted on the Charlotte Eagles website
on Monday morning.
